Primary Consultation

You can properly determine the patients’ candidacy after completing a dental implant training course. You need to determine the candidacy during primary consultation with the help of certain factors. It is not enough to examine the conditions of teeth and gums of your patients. You need to assess the density and quantity of bones during primary consultation.

You may need to use x-rays or CT scans in order to determine the amount of bone loss. This information helps you assess the sufficiency of bone structure for the placement of implants. It also helps you properly identify the area of implant placement. You need to devise personalized treatment plans based on different necessities of your patients. Tool Utilization

You need a surgical scalpel to incise the overlying gum tissue and reach the underlying jawbone. You need an elevator to peel and push the flaps of gum-tissues back. You need a drill to create a pilot hole for the insertion of implant’s root. You also need a screw-tap to create threads inside the drilled hole. The structure of these threads needs to match the threads on implants’ roots. You need exclusive training to learn these details.
